Annual Roof Inspections Help Identify Problems Early

For most homeowners, scheduling professional roof inspections once each year is a practical approach to maintaining the condition of the roofing system. Annual evaluations allow roofing professionals to detect developing issues before they compromise the roof’s ability to protect the home.

Regular inspections help:

  • Identify minor damage before it becomes a larger repair. Loose shingles, deteriorating flashing, and small areas of wear can often be corrected before they lead to water intrusion or structural damage.
  • Monitor the condition of roofing materials. Roofing professionals can evaluate how materials are aging and determine whether maintenance or repairs are needed to extend the roof’s service life.
  • Prepare the roof for seasonal weather. Scheduling an inspection before periods of heavy rain, snow, or high winds helps ensure the roofing system is ready to perform under changing weather conditions.

A consistent inspection schedule allows homeowners to make informed maintenance decisions while reducing the risk of unexpected roofing issues.

Schedule an Inspection After Severe Weather Events

Severe weather can affect a roofing system even when there are no obvious signs of damage. High winds, hail, heavy rainfall, and snow accumulation may weaken roofing materials or create small openings that allow moisture to enter over time.

After significant weather events, roof inspection services can help identify damage such as the following:

  • Wind-related damage. Strong winds may loosen shingles, lift roofing materials, or damage flashing around vulnerable areas.
  • Hail impacts. Hail can crack, bruise, or weaken roofing materials, reducing their ability to protect the home over time.
  • Snow and ice accumulation. Heavy snow or ice dams may place additional stress on the roof and contribute to moisture-related concerns.
  • Drainage issues after heavy rainfall. Excessive rain can expose clogged drainage systems or reveal areas where water is entering the home.

A professional inspection following severe weather provides a clear assessment of the roof’s condition and helps prevent hidden damage from becoming a larger problem.

Older Roofs Require More Frequent Monitoring

As a roof ages, regular evaluations become increasingly important. Years of exposure to the elements naturally affect roofing materials, making older systems more susceptible to wear, moisture intrusion, and declining performance.

More frequent inspections can help homeowners:

  • Monitor aging roofing materials. Shingles, flashing, and sealants gradually deteriorate, and regular evaluations help determine when repairs are necessary.
  • Plan for future maintenance. Understanding the current condition of an older roof allows homeowners to budget for repairs or replacement before major issues develop.
  • Reduce the risk of unexpected damage. Identifying aging components early often prevents minor concerns from becoming emergency repairs.

Look for Warning Signs Between Professional Inspections

Although annual inspections are recommended, homeowners should also pay attention to visible signs that may indicate a roofing issue before their next scheduled evaluation.

Some common warning signs include:

  • Water stains on ceilings or walls. Interior discoloration often indicates moisture is entering through the roofing system and should be inspected promptly.
  • Missing, cracked, or curling shingles. Damaged shingles reduce the roof’s ability to protect against water infiltration and weather exposure.
  • Granules are collecting in gutters. Excessive granule loss may indicate that roofing materials are nearing the end of their service life.
  • Sagging roof sections. Uneven areas along the roofline can indicate structural concerns that require immediate professional evaluation.
  • Damaged flashing around roof penetrations. Worn or separated flashing near chimneys, vents, and skylights can allow water to enter the home if left unaddressed.

If any of these conditions are present, scheduling professional roof inspections as soon as possible can help prevent additional damage.

Why Professional Roof Inspections Provide Better Results

While a homeowner may notice obvious signs of damage, a professional inspection provides a much more complete evaluation of the roofing system. Experienced roofing contractors know where problems commonly develop and can identify concerns that may not be visible during a routine visual check.

Professional roof inspection services typically include:

  • A thorough assessment of roofing materials. Contractors evaluate shingles, underlayment, flashing, and other components for signs of wear or damage.
  • Inspection of vulnerable areas. Roof penetrations, valleys, flashing, and sealants are carefully examined for potential moisture entry points.
  • Evaluation of ventilation and drainage. Proper airflow and effective drainage are essential for maintaining the long-term performance of the roofing system.
  • Review of the roof’s structural condition. Inspectors look for signs of sagging, weakened decking, or other structural concerns that may affect the roof’s stability.

A detailed inspection provides homeowners with an accurate understanding of their roof’s condition, allowing maintenance decisions to be based on professional findings rather than visible symptoms alone.
